Coal Started This Story

When coal was being used pretty much exclusively in the Business Revolution, it was actually the norm. Nobody was worried about finding another source of fuel, though they were beginning to use biomass and traditional fuels, and wood had been used for a while. The utilization of solar power was first considered in the 1860s as scientists thought that coal was becoming less available. But in the early twentieth century, coal and petrol were again typically available, and were not too expensive.

During the oil embargo ( 1973 ) and the energy crisis ( 1979 ), the govt. ‘s energy policies worldwide were under inspection. There had been replenished interest in developing solar technologies. Govt developed special programs with motivations, like the Sunlight Program in Japan. The US had the Federal Photovoltaic Function Program. Regimes in several nations also developed research facilities ( US, Japan, and Germany were outstanding. )

To be fair, in the US there had already been commercial solar water heaters since the 1890s. There were inflating number of users of these systems, till there were more trustworthy and less expensive fuels. Solar heating was of interest in the oil crisis that occurred in the 1970s but when the cost of petrol went down, so did interest in solar water heaters.

Since the 1990s, there has been increased interest in solar water heating, and now it is the most popular solar technology. There are other used of solar energy, however.

For office buildings, solar energy can offer day lighting systems and reduced need for air con.

For farming, solar power can run the pumps, wine presses, and even the chick brooders.

For cooking, solar power is utilized for cooking, drying, and pasteurization. These can be of varied forms, from reflector ovens ( remember using those while camping? ), panel cookers, which use solar cells to collect heat, and box cookers. These can reach temperatures satisfactory to cook just about anything.
